WebWhen Hurricane Katrina made landfall in August 2005, between 70,000 and 100,000 residents of New Orleans either did not or could not comply with the order that had been issued to evacuate. The events surrounding Katrina raised critical legal and ethical questions about the use of mandatory evacuation orders. We discuss four key ethical …

Webworkplace advocacy issues for registered nurses who live in and or employed in areas that are at high risk for catastrophic outcomes as a result of natural disasters. Current position statements address issues involving the rights, responsibilities, and deployment of registered nurses to disaster areas post-disaster (ANA, 2002a & 2002b).
